OFFICER INFORMATION:
Our NHS chapter will select four officers each year. Those officers, and their basic responsibilities, are:
1) President - Provides overall leadership for our chapter and ensures that our chapter and its members are fulfilling their duties and responsibilities. Presides over NHS meetings and functions.
2) Vice-President - Provides leadership to our chapter and assists the president with carrying out his/her responsibilities.
3) Secretary - Keeps the official records of NHS activities, including meeting minutes and attendance.
4) Treasurer - Keeps track of NHS revenue and expenses and helps to plan the budget for each year.
Our officers are very important to the success of our chapter; please consider running to be an officer! The time commitment is not excessive, but you will participate in one other meeting per month with Ms. King and Mrs. Daniels (Ms. Everett) to help plan the activities for our chapter. In addition, as officers you will be expected to attend and lead all other NHS functions.

- September 21: Next Steps for NHS Candidates
September 18 was the final deadline for submission of NHS applications. The materials will be reviewed by the FVHS NHS Faculty Council to determine the students who will be offered membership. It is important to note that students are not compared to each other but rather to the standard for membership. Any student who meets the standard will be offered membership -- there is no minimum or maximum number of people who can be a part of the NHS.
The decision of the Faculty Council will be announced on or before October 14.
The induction ceremony for new members is October 21. Inductees must arrive at 5:30 p.m. for practice. The ceremony begins at 7 p.m.
